a cone and a sphere have the same volume. the height of the cone is 96 units. what would be the values for the radius of the con
jolli1 [7]

The volume V_c of a cone  with base radius r_c and height h_c is

V_c = \dfrac{1}{3}\pi r_c^2 h_c

Similarly, the volume V_s of a sphere with radius r_s is

V_s = \dfrac{4}{3}\pi r_s^3

We know that V_c=V_s and that h_c=96

So, we can set up the following equation:

\dfrac{96}{3}\pi r_c^2=\dfrac{4}{3}\pi r_s^3

We can simplify the common denominator 3, and pi appearing on both sides:

96r_c^2=4r_s^3

We can divide both sides by 4:

24r_c^2=r_s^3

Without further information, this is all we can say: the cubed radius of the sphere is the same as 24 times the squared radius of the cone.
